    Transfer Audio Files from a Windows PC:

    1. Connect the LG Class to your computer via USB
    2. When prompted, tap to enable “Media sync (MTP)” (otherwise enable the option from the notification area)
    3. On the computer, open an Explorer window and navigate to the audio files on your computer
    4. Copy the files, and navigate to the phone storage
    5. Paste the files on the phone’s memory, preferably in the “Media” directory
    6. After the transfer is done, click “Safely Remove Hardware” in the system tray to eject the phone
    7. Safely disconnect the device from the USB connector

    Change the Ringtone:

    1. Open the apps drawer
    2. Go to “Settings
    3. Tap “Sound & notification
    4. Tap “Ringtone” and select the desired ringtone
    5. Tap “OK” to confirm

    Change the Ringtone of a Contact:

    NOTE: You cannot set custom ringtones to contacts stored on the SIM or the phone’s internal storage.

    1. Open “Contacts
    2. Select the desired contact
    3. Tap “Edit” (icon shaped like a pencil)
    4. Tap “Ringtone
    5. Select the desired ringtone and press “OK” to confirm

    Change the Notification Sound:

    1. Open the apps drawer
    2. Access “Settings
    3. Tap “Sound & notifications
    4. Tap “More” under “Advanced Settings
    5. Tap “Notification sound
    6. Select the desired sound and tap “OK
